#49a292 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#49a292 is composed of 28.6% red, 63.5%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.9%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 169.2 degrees, a saturation of 37.9% and a lightness of 46.1%. #49a292 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ffff with #004525.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#49a292

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060d0c is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#49a292

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d7e7b is the less saturated color, while #01eac0 is the most saturated one.
